Why Volunteer?

As an Orientations leader, you have the rewarding job of welcoming over 8,000 incoming first-year, international, and transfer students, and their parents, to UBC. You’ll work in a team environment, gain event-planning experience, and help make UBC a great place for incoming new students.

The benefits of being a leader:

  • You’ll gain valuable mentoring skills
  • You’ll have a chance to practice your public-speaking skills
  • You’ll get the opportunity to attend the summer Leadership Recognition Event
  • You’ll get a free I AM UBC T-shirt
  • You’ll be able to leave a lasting impression on the orientation and transition experience of new-to-UBC students
